Tonio
bulletTonio's real name: Antonio Vladimer Stephen Michael Krikorian, born in 1950
bulletTonio K. is an amalgam of Kafka’s famed protagonist and the Thomas Mann short story, "Tonio Kroger," as well as "Kazak," the hound of space in Kurt Vonnegut’s novels
bulletGadfly Records has re-released all of Tonio K's albums (with the exception of the EP La Bomba) including Ole', which Tonio's record label would not release in 1989.
bulletGadfly Records has released a new Tonio K album of songs "from the archives" which had not been previously released.  The album is titled "Rodent Weekend 1976-96 (Approximately)"
